This skills programme is intended for health workers in the community who will provide mentoring and support for the client who is receiving Anti-retroviral (ARV) treatment as well as learners who counsel people in a variety of situations, especially in the area of HIV/AIDS but who are not registered professionals such as qualified psychologists and social workers. The Health and Welfare Sector Education and Training Authority (HWSETA) was one of the original 23 SETAs established by law in South Africa in 1998, and it has, like all the rest, been operating for the past ten years. A Skills Programme is an occupation-based learning programme aimed at building skills that have economic value, and which incorporates at least one unit standard.
